First, understand the types of eye care providers. An optometrist (OD) is your primary eye doctor for comprehensive exams, diagnosing common conditions, and prescribing glasses or contact lenses. An ophthalmologist (MD) is a medical doctor who can perform surgery and treat complex eye diseases. For most routine vision care, an optometrist is the perfect place to start. When looking for an 'eye dr near me,' consider the local lifestyle. Edinburg's expansive skies and agricultural surroundings mean increased exposure to UV rays, dust, and wind. A good local eye doctor will emphasize the importance of high-quality sunglasses with 100% UV protection and discuss protective eyewear for outdoor work. They'll also be familiar with conditions like dry eye, which can be exacerbated by North Dakota's harsh winters and windy seasons, and can recommend effective treatments.
Practical steps for your search include checking with your insurance provider for in-network doctors and asking for personal recommendations from neighbors or your primary care physician at the local clinic. Don't hesitate to call a practice and ask questions: What are their hours? Do they handle emergencies? Can they manage specific issues like diabetes-related eye care? Given our distance from major cities, knowing their capabilities for urgent care is crucial.
Finally, prioritize a doctor who makes you feel comfortable and listens to your concerns. A comprehensive eye exam is a key part of your overall health, detecting not just vision changes but also signs of systemic conditions like hypertension or diabetes.
